bigaadams Posted July 28, 2022 Share Posted July 28, 2022 The clubs that revolve about the small Brit cars here in the US especially my quadrant of America seem to dwell around show only with a hospitality room, local tour events and a wine and dine at the end of the awards ceremony. Too much pomp and circumstance/pedigree for the average 'get your hands dirty' owner/builder of the various makes and models and they have all but done away with the swap meet portion of the shows. The last two events/shows I attended had no swap section though advertised and at that save a couple folks were often just offering books on x models for sale or trinkets like Union Jack logo stuff. At most these books were "the story of..." and nothing but picture books with zero pertinent data to the repair and maintenance at any degree....a coffee table book if you will for idle minds. I think many organizers do not like the 'organized chaos' of the display of used parts and such in and about the arena of the event. Whatever their thinking, the lack of a swap meet has totally turned me from any attending any future Brit car show event. Not worth the time or trouble to attend. Don't get me wrong, I like a clean finished car as much as the next man, I just prefer having access to parts to be able to reach that point in a build just a tad bit better.....the combined event of swap and show is truly a win win and many meets are shooting themselves int eh foot for gate money by not hosting the swap.
